美发店管理系统课程设计说明书.docx
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
【美发店管理系统课程设计说明书】 本课程设计的目的是通过使用Java编程语言,构建一个针对美发店的管理系统,以实现店铺的信息化管理和优化运营流程。该系统旨在满足美发店的各项管理需求,如预约、服务记录、员工管理、财务统计等功能。下面将详细介绍系统的设计目标、环境、要求及工作进度。 1. 设计任务 本系统旨在为美发店提供一个集成化的管理平台,涵盖功能包括但不限于客户预约、员工管理、服务项目管理、财务报表生成等。系统应能够适应美发店的日常运营需求,引入现代化管理理念,提高工作效率。 2. 设计环境 硬件环境:个人计算机 软件环境:Windows操作系统,开发工具选用JDK/Eclipse/MyEclipse,数据库采用MySQL/SQL Server/Access。 3. 成果要求 - 设计说明书:详尽阐述系统功能、设计思路、实现方法,保证内容完整、概念清晰。 - 设计系统:需实现所有预设功能,执行效率高,用户界面友好,交互性强。 - 编码规范:采用模块化设计,标识符命名标准,程序书写格式统一,注释充足,可读性好。 4. 工作进度 - 选题及需求分析阶段:确定设计方案,完成任务书。 - 需求分析与概要设计:绘制系统模块功能表,确定算法和限制条件,定义模块界面和所需数据。 - 编程与调试:编写并调试程序。 - 详细设计与测试:完成详细设计部分,测试程序运行效果。 - 完成文档与源代码:编写结论与心得,准备答辩材料,提交所有成果。 - 答辩与修改:根据答辩意见修改系统和说明书,提交源代码。 5. 主要参考资料 提供了多本关于Java编程的书籍作为设计参考,包括耿祥义、张跃平、贺伟、李凤、张思民、毕广吉和王保罗等人的著作。 6. 功能描述 - 预约管理:允许客户在线预约美发服务,系统自动处理预约冲突。 - 服务管理:记录每个服务项目,包括价格、时长等信息。 - 员工管理:包括员工信息录入、考勤、业绩统计等。 - 财务统计:自动生成各类财务报表,如收入、支出、利润等。 - 客户管理:存储客户信息,追踪消费记录,提供个性化的服务推荐。 7. 程序模块 - 用户模块:包括用户登录、注册、个人信息管理等。 - 预约模块:预约服务、取消预约、查看预约状态。 - 服务模块:添加、编辑、删除服务项目。 - 员工模块:员工信息录入、更新、查询等。 - 财务模块:输入收支数据,生成报表。 - 管理员模块:具有全部操作权限,用于系统维护和管理。 8. 对象关系与设计 系统中涉及的对象包括用户、预约、服务、员工和财务记录等,它们之间存在多种关联,例如用户与预约的一对多关系,服务与预约的多对多关系,员工与服务的多对多关系等,通过数据库设计来实现这些关系。 9. 界面设计 系统的用户界面应直观易用,包括登录界面、主界面、各项功能的操作界面等,采用图形化设计,使用户能快速理解并进行操作。 通过这个课程设计,学生不仅能够深入理解和掌握Java面向对象编程,还能实际运用到项目开发中,提高解决实际问题的能力。同时,此系统也将为美发店提供一套实用的管理工具,提升其业务运营的效率和质量。
剩余37页未读,继续阅读
- HHFZ8752023-01-05资源不错,内容挺好的,有一定的使用价值,值得借鉴,感谢分享。
- 去見你2022-12-23这个资源对我启发很大,受益匪浅,学到了很多,谢谢分享~
- m0_658206752023-01-04感谢资源主的分享,很值得参考学习,资源价值较高,支持!
- 粉丝: 2
- 资源: 2
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助